What Does Desiccant Packets Mean . desiccants are hygroscopic materials that adsorb moisture from the air. As an oxygen absorber is to air, a desiccant is to moisture. They are often placed in packets made of kraft paper bags, tyvek ®, or custom. It is most commonly used to remove humidity that would normally degrade or even destroy products sensitive to moisture. These materials assist in the reduction and the maintenance of low humidity levels that may cause damage to many products.
